The Orvane Labs bike cage and the east and west parking gates operate on separate access schedules, and facilities desk staff should note that visitor vehicles may only use the west gate between 07:00 and 19:00. Cyclists requesting cage access must show a valid day pass, and their details should be entered in the access ledger before the cage is opened. Gates must never be propped open, even briefly, during deliveries. When a manual override is required at either gate, use the code below.

staff pass of fadup-fawig = bdg-FUNKS-4

# ProctorQueue env — notes for the weekly sync
# Quick heads up: the Lanternview exam-proctoring queue now pulls
# jobs from the new broker, so the old polling vars are gone.
# Throughput looked fine in Tuesday's load test, ~400 sessions.
# Don't touch the concurrency settings without pinging the infra crew.
# The broker won't accept connections without its signing credential,
# which must be set on the very next line.

env line for kageg-fajof: COURIER_KEY5=93d14

Handover for the Lanternbird firmware update channel. Devices poll the Stagegate service hourly; releases move through canary, beta, then stable rings. Promotion is manual — never skip canary soak, minimum 48 hours. Rollbacks are done by re-pinning the prior build in the ring config. Dashboards live under the Fernvale monitoring space. Questions about ring promotions should go to the channel owner named below.

account owner for bawip-tahag: Raleth Quenok

# For the security review: all non-sensitive settings (batch size, retry window,
# dedupe mode) live in config/import.toml and are versioned. Only values that must
# never enter source control belong in this file. Rotation happens quarterly via
# the ops vault. The one sensitive value this file carries is set on the next line.

secret setting of baduf-fahag: LEDGER_TOKEN8=35e35511